-#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:6 -msgid "" -"This chapter discusses fine-tuning customization of the live system contents " -"beyond merely choosing which packages to include. Includes allow you to add " -"or replace arbitrary files in your live system image, hooks allow you to " -"execute arbitrary commands at different stages of the build and at boot " -"time, and preseeding allows you to configure packages when they are " -"installed by supplying answers to debconf questions."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:8 -msgid "2~includes Includes"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:10 -msgid "" -"While ideally a live system would include files entirely provided by " -"unmodified packages, it is sometimes convenient to provide or modify some " -"content by means of files. Using includes, it is possible to add (or " -"replace) arbitrary files in your live system image. live-build provides two " -"mechanisms for using them:"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:12 -msgid "" -"_* Chroot local includes: These allow you to add or replace files to the " -"chroot/Live filesystem. Please see {Live/chroot local includes}#live-chroot-" -"local-includes for more information."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:14 -msgid "" -"_* Binary local includes: These allow you to add or replace files in the " -"binary image. Please see {Binary local includes}#binary-local-includes for " -"more information."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:16 -msgid "" -"Please see {Terms}#terms for more information about the distinction between " -"the \"Live\" and \"binary\" images."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:18 -msgid "3~live-chroot-local-includes Live/chroot local includes"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:20 -msgid "" -"Chroot local includes can be used to add or replace files in the chroot/Live " -"filesystem so that they may be used in the Live system. A typical use is to " -"populate the skeleton user directory (#{/etc/skel}#) used by the Live system " -"to create the live user's home directory. Another is to supply configuration " -"files that can be simply added or replaced in the image without processing; " -"see {Live/chroot local hooks}#live-chroot-local-hooks if processing is " -"needed."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:22 -msgid "" -"To include files, simply add them to your #{config/includes.chroot}# " -"directory. This directory corresponds to the root directory #{/}# of the " -"live system. For example, to add a file #{/var/www/index.html}# in the live " -"system, use:"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:27 -#, no-wrap -msgid "" -" $ mkdir -p config/includes.chroot/var/www\n" -" $ cp /path/to/my/index.html config/includes.chroot/var/www\n"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:31 -msgid "Your configuration will then have the following layout:"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:41 -#, no-wrap -msgid "" -" -- config\n" -" [...]\n" -" |-- includes.chroot\n" -" | `-- var\n" -" | `-- www\n" -" | `-- index.html\n" -" [...]\n"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:45 -msgid "" -"Chroot local includes are installed after package installation so that files " -"installed by packages are overwritten."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:47 -msgid "3~binary-local-includes Binary local includes"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:49 -msgid "" -"To include material such as documentation or videos on the medium filesystem " -"so that it is accessible immediately upon insertion of the medium without " -"booting the Live system, you can use binary local includes. This works in a " -"similar fashion to chroot local includes. For example, suppose the files #{~/" -"video_demo.*}# are demo videos of the live system described by and linked to " -"by an HTML index page. Simply copy the material to #{config/includes.binary/}" -"# as follows:"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:53 -#, no-wrap -msgid " $ cp ~/video_demo.* config/includes.binary/\n"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:57 -msgid "These files will now appear in the root directory of the live medium."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:59 -msgid "2~hooks Hooks"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:61 -msgid "" -"Hooks allow commands to be performed in the chroot and binary stages of the " -"build in order to customize the image."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:63 -msgid "3~live-chroot-local-hooks Live/chroot local hooks"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:65 -msgid "" -"To run commands in the chroot stage, create a hook script with a #{.hook." -"chroot}# suffix containing the commands in the #{config/hooks/}# directory. " -"The hook will run in the chroot after the rest of your chroot configuration " -"has been applied, so remember to ensure your configuration includes all " -"packages and files your hook needs in order to run. See the example chroot " -"hook scripts for various common chroot customization tasks provided in #{/" -"usr/share/doc/live-build/examples/hooks}# which you can copy or symlink to " -"use them in your own configuration."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:67 -msgid "3~boot-time-hooks Boot-time hooks"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:69 -msgid "" -"To execute commands at boot time, you can supply live-config hooks as " -"explained in the \"Customization\" section of its man page. Examine live-" -"config's own hooks provided in #{/lib/live/config/}#, noting the sequence " -"numbers. Then provide your own hook prefixed with an appropriate sequence " -"number, either as a chroot local include in #{config/includes.chroot/lib/" -"live/config/}#, or as a custom package as discussed in {Installing modified " -"or third-party packages}#installing-modified-or-third-party-packages."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:71 -msgid "3~ Binary local hooks"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:73 -msgid "" -"To run commands in the binary stage, create a hook script with a #{.hook." -"binary}# suffix containing the commands in the #{config/hooks/}# directory. " -"The hook will run after all other binary commands are run, but before " -"binary_checksums, the very last binary command. The commands in your hook do " -"not run in the chroot, so take care to not modify any files outside of the " -"build tree, or you may damage your build system! See the example binary hook " -"scripts for various common binary customization tasks provided in #{/usr/" -"share/doc/live-build/examples/hooks}# which you can copy or symlink to use " -"them in your own configuration."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:75 -msgid "2~ Preseeding Debconf questions" -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:77 -msgid "" -"Files in the #{config/preseed/}# directory suffixed with #{.cfg}# followed " -"by the stage (#{.chroot}# or #{.binary}#) are considered to be debconf " -"preseed files and are installed by live-build using #{debconf-set-selections}" -"# during the corresponding stage." -msgstr "" - -#. type: Plain text -#: en/user_customization-contents.ssi:78 -msgid "" -"For more information about debconf, please see #{debconf(7)}# in the /" -"{debconf}/ package." -msgstr "" |
